Struts的控制器如何知道什么样的信息转发到什么样的Action类呢?
2014-09-22 10:39
323 查看
在struts中,控制器信息转发的配置映射信息是存储在特定的XML文件(比如struts-config.xml)中的。这些配置信息在系统启动的时候被读入内存,供struts framework在运行期间使用。在内存中,每一个<action>元素都与org.apache.struts.action.ActionMapping类的一个实例对应。当可以通过/logonAction.do(此处假设配置的控制器映射为*.do)提交请求信息的时候,控制器将信息委托com.test.LogonAction处理。调用LogonAction实例的execute()方法。同时将Mapping实例和所对应的LogonFormBean信息传入。其中name=LogonForm,使用的form-bean元素所声明的ActionForm
Bean.
Bean.
相关文章推荐
- 在struts2.0的action中如何弹出信息提示
- 在struts2.0的action中如何弹出信息提示
- 在struts2.0的action中如何弹出信息提示
- 如何成功调试《Struts in Action》的第一例
- 如何在struts项目中让标签的page属性的值可以是action的路径
- 如何在struts中的action的execute方法()中弹出对话框
- struts2之Action配置的各项默认值、result配置的各种试图转发类型及为应用指定多个struts配置文件
- 使用struts 怎么才能在执行完js校验页面的信息,发现不全的情况下,不让页面提交到Action中
- 自学SSH框架之---struts(三):源码分析struts1如何实现Action单例模式
- Struts 1.2 如何测试Action
- struts.xm中设置参数时如何调用Action中的属性
- struts2中action如何获取Session,request,jsp页面参数等等信息的值
- 如何使Struts的本地信息文件ApplicationResources.properties支持中文
- 知道一条信息的TMsvId,如何打开信息浏览视图
- 知道如何上去?也得知道如何下来--Struts 2 下载文件(13)
- Struts 1.2 中如何测试Action
- struts的action中使用ActionForward来转发,redirect
- 如何使用Spring来管理Struts中的Action
- 如何使用Spring来管理Struts中的Action
- 如何知道GetLastError()返回的错误信息